Onstage is a two-story house. From one angle, it’s mucked out after a flood. From another, it’s a new development wrapped in Tyvek. And from another, it’s “Tara” from Gone with the Wind being transformed into an Airbnb. The piano can’t be tuned. Someone is quilting in the corner. Come in.
Co-written by 21 Black-, POC-, and white-identifying artists ranging in age from 29 to 99, RECONSTRUCTING is a new work by internationally-renowned theater collective the TEAM that wrestles with how, in the aftermath of slavery, we might move through history together. Propelled by a quilt-like score, this “complex and combustible project” (Sarah Holdren, Vulture) slips between fact and fiction and performance and ritual to tell a story of historical figures and fictional characters seeking and fleeing intimacy—and us as makers doing the same

About The TEAM (Artistic Director: Rachel Chavkin; Producing Director: Emma Orme)
Founded in 2004, the TEAM is an internationally-renowned Brooklyn-based experimental theatre collective, spirited by some of the wildest and deepest artists working today. Once described by The Guardian as “theatrical excavators of American culture, American dreams, and the American psyche,” the TEAM collaboratively creates new works about the experience of living in the United States today to generate dialogue about our nation’s past, present, and future through production and touring. We believe how we make is as important as what we make, and our producing practices strive to embody our values of collective liberation.
To date, we have created and toured 12 works, including Mission Drift and RoosevElvis, and our work has been seen at venues such as National Theatre of London, The Public, PS122, The Bushwick Starr, ArtsEmerson, A.R.T., Walker Art Center, Edinburgh’s Traverse Theatre, Almeida Theatre, the Salzburg Festival, Perth International Arts Festival, Hong Kong Arts Festival, and more.
